Ahmedabad: Gujarat Gas Limited Market Capitalization (GGL) across Rs 50,000 Crore on Friday.
With this, five companies based in Gujarat have reached this historical milestone in 2021 behind a strong rally in their stock price.
Apart from Gujarat’s GGG, four other companies to make it reach Hospital 50,000 Crore and more M-Cap Club this year is Cadila Healthcare Ltd, Torrent Pharmaceuticals Ltd., Adani Total Gas Ltd (ATGL) and Adani Transmission Ltd (ATL)).
The number of Gujarati companies at the downloaded club has more than doubled by 2021 by soaring the equity market.
Before the current calendar year, a company that has a market limit above Rs 50,000 Crore includes people such as Adani Enterprises Limited (AEL), Adani Green Energy Limited and Port Adani and Special Economic Zone (APSEZ).
Most of these companies have registered a market limit of more than RS 50,000 Crore this year comes from the distribution of city gas (CGD) and the pharmaceutical sector.
“CGD players such as GGGL and ATGL have benefited from the increase in demand and consumption of natural gas, while pharmaceutical companies have been obtained from demand growth after the Covid-19 pandemic,” said Nilesh Box, a city-based stock analyst.
“The share price of Cadila Healthcare almost doubled within a year after its strong finances and development related to the Covid-19 vaccine,” said Aasif Hirani, Director at a Ahmedabad-based brokerage company.
